46. WORD IN WORD IS A WORD

As the title says a WORD that has a WORD inside a WORD.

Find the synonym for the 1st clue.

Find the synonym for the 2nd clue.

Now insert the 2nd synonym in the first appropriately to arrive at a synonym for the full word of the 3rd clue.

The number of letters in the word solutions for the 1st and 2nd synonyms are given in brackets)

Example
1. Make an effort (3) the grand finale within (3) leading to latest fad
Ans: TRY, END, TRENDY
2. Angle (4) and a cremated ash container within (3) to equip and outfit.
Ans: FISH, URN, FURNISH
3. A cent or a paise (4) contains you and me (2) making us kith & kin
Ans: COIN, US, COUSIN

44. VOWEL LINK

Find the words/synonyms for the first two clues given.

Link the two words with a vowel to form the word/synonym for the final clue.

The number of letters for each of the 3 clues are given in brackets.

Example
1. Troupe (4)-crackpot (4). A marsupial (9)
Ans: BAND, COOT, BANDICOOT
2. Choose (3) - mute (3). Ideal (7)
Ans: OPT, MUM, OPTIMUM
3. A loop or aureole (4) - to a high degree (4). Finding or uncovering (9).
Ans: DISC, VERY, DISCOVERY

41. PHONETRIX

A semi rebus involving tricky phonetics.

Find the two word synonyms for the earlier part of the clue.

Now the two words read phonetically should be the synonym for the last part of the clue.

The number of letters in the first two words and the final word are given in brackets.

Example
1. At what time wilt thou be (4,3). Concert spot(5)
Ans: WHEN YOU: VENUE
2. Bristle crater (4,4). L earner) (7)
Ans: STEW DENT : STUDENT
3. Pry with anger (5,4) . Influence (8)
Ans: LEVER RAGE : LEVERAGE

35. MATRYOSHKA 3 IN 1

Each Q has 3 clues.

Find synonym for the first clue.

Then synonym for the 2nd clue.

Now insert 1st word in the 2nd, appropriately to get a synonym for the 3rd clue.

The number of letters in the synonyms for each clue is given in brackets.

Example
1. Stop (4) Jelly made of meat stock (5) - Mixture of bitumen, grave and sand (9)
Ans: HALT, ASPIC - ASPHALTIC
2. Clear alcoholic spirit (3) Rapidly and widely spread (5). - Celibate (8)
Ans: GIN, VIRAL - VIRGINAL
3. Impulsive (4), An object (5) - Defeating heavily in a match (9)
Ans: RASH, THING - THRASHING

17. DOUBLE GUILLOTINE

Select the word to be a synonym for the first clue.

Now behead it (remove the first letter) and behold you get a synonym for the second clue.

Now the beheaded word beheld needs to be beheaded once more to become a synonym of the third clue.

The number of letters in the 3 words are given in brackets

Example
1.. Scale, Fragrance, Small coin (6,5,4)
Ans: ASCENT – SCENT - CENT
2. Charge, Food grain, Assassinate (slang) (5,4,3)
Ans: PRICE – RICE - ICE
3. Berate, Chilly, Aged (5,4,3)
Ans: SCOLD-COLD-OLD
